The Role of IPL in Shaping Careers
The IPL has transformed Indian cricket, offering unprecedented opportunities for young players to showcase their skills on a global stage. However, as Shaw’s case illustrates, the league’s fast-paced environment can also be unforgiving. The IPL’s financial stakes and media coverage amplify the pressure on young players, who often find themselves in uncharted territory both professionally and personally.
Amre’s comparison of Shaw’s earnings to those of an IIM graduate highlights the stark differences in career trajectories and expectations. While corporate careers involve a gradual climb, IPL stars are thrust into the limelight with enormous financial rewards almost overnight. This sudden shift requires exceptional maturity and a strong support system, which not all players are equipped with at a young age.
